.sf-menu, .sf-menu *{margin:0;padding:0;list-style:none;}
.sf-menu{line-height:1.0;}
.sf-menu ul{position:absolute;top:-999em;width:15em;}
.sf-menu ul li{width:100%;}
.sf-menu li:hover{visibility:inherit;}
.sf-menu li{float:left;position:relative;}
.sf-menu a{display:block;position:relative;}
.sf-menu li li a{font-size:1em;border-right:0 none;padding:0.75em 1.5em;z-index:99;}
.sf-menu ul li a:hover{color:#FFF !important;}
ul.sf-menu li.no_desc:hover ul, ul.sf-menu li.no_desc.sfHover ul{left:0;top:3em;z-index:99;}
ul.sf-menu li.no_desc li:hover ul, ul.sf-menu li.no_desc li.sfHover ul{left:0;top:0em;z-index:99;}
ul.sf-menu li.have_desc:hover ul, ul.sf-menu li.have_desc.sfHover ul{left:0;top:4.4em;z-index:99;}
ul.sf-menu li.have_desc li:hover ul, ul.sf-menu li.have_desc li.sfHover ul{left:0;top:0em;z-index:99;}
.sf-menu li:hover ul, .sf-menu li.sfHover ul{left:0.125em;top:3em;z-index:99;}
ul.sf-menu li:hover li ul, ul.sf-menu li.sfHover li ul{top:-999em;}
ul.sf-menu li li:hover ul, ul.sf-menu li li.sfHover ul{left:12em;top:0;}
ul.sf-menu li li:hover li ul, ul.sf-menu li li.sfHover li ul{top:-999em;}
ul.sf-menu li li li:hover ul, ul.sf-menu li li li.sfHover ul{left:12em;top:0;}
#top-navigation .sf-menu li:hover,#top-navigation .sf-menu ul{background-color:#B4260E;}
#top-navigation .sf-menu li{}
.sf-menu li li:last-child,.sf-menu li li li:last-child{border-bottom:0 none !important;}
.sf-menu{}
.sf-menu li:before{display:none;}
#top-navigation .sf-menu a{text-decoration:none;display:block;font-size:1.35em;padding:0.75em 1.25em;color:#FFF;margin:0px;}
#main-navigation .sf-menu a{text-decoration:none;display:block;font-size:1.25em;padding:0.75em 1em;color:#333;margin:0px;border-bottom:5px solid #52C0D4;}
#main-navigation .sf-menu a:hover{background:#52C0D4 none;color:#fff;}
#top-navigation .sf-menu a:hover{background:#8E1E0C none;color:#fff;}
.sf-menu a span.menu-decsription{font-size:0.75em !important;font-weight:normal !important;color:#fff;}
#top-navigation .sf-menu a span.menu-decsription{opacity:.7;}
#main-navigation .sf-menu a span.menu-decsription{display:inline;color:#333;opacity:.8;}
#main-navigation .sf-menu li:hover a span.menu-decsription{color:#fff;}
#main-navigation .sf-menu li{margin-right:5px;}
.sf-menu .current_page_item a span.menu-decsription, .sf-menu .current_menu_item a span.menu-decsription, .sf-menu .current-menu-item a span.menu-decsription{color:#fff;}
.sf-menu li li a span.menu-decsription{}
.sf-menu li a:hover{color:#FFF;text-decoration:none;}
.sf-menu a, .sf-menu a:visited{}
.sf-menu li{}
.sf-menu li.no_desc a{}
.sf-menu li li.no_desc a{height:auto !important;}
#main-navigation .sf-menu ul{margin:0px;padding:0px;background:#52C0D4 none;}
.sf-menu li li,.sf-menu li li li{}
.sf-cat-menu li li,.sf-cat-menu li li li{}
.sf-menu li li:last-child,.sf-menu li li li:last-child{border-bottom:0 none !important;}
.sf-menu ul li a{color:#FFF !important;border:0 none !important;text-decoration:none;font-size:0.875em !important;letter-spacing:normal;padding:0.75em 2em !important;}
.sf-menu ul li a:hover{color:#FFF !important;border-top:0 none;border-right:0 none !important;border-left:0 none;text-decoration:none;background-color:#0046A6;background-image:none;}
.main-nav .sf-menu ul li a:hover{color:#FFF !important;background-color:#2FBCD5;background-image:none;}
.sf-menu .current_page_item a, .sf-menu .current_menu_item a, .sf-menu .current-menu-item a,.sf-menu .current_page_item a:hover, .sf-menu .current_menu_item a:hover, .sf-menu .current-menu-item a:hover{outline:0;text-decoration:none;color:#FFF;background-color:transparent;}
.sf-menu li:hover, .sf-menu li.sfHover, .sf-menu a:focus, .sf-menu a:hover, .sf-menu a:active{outline:0;color:#fff;text-decoration:none;}
.sf-menu a.sf-with-ul{padding-right:2.25em !important;min-width:1px;}
ul .sf-sub-indicator{top:1em;}
ul ul .sf-sub-indicator{top:1em !important;}
a > .sf-sub-indicator{top:1em;background-position:0 -100px;}
a:focus > .sf-sub-indicator, a:hover > .sf-sub-indicator, a:active > .sf-sub-indicator, li:hover > a > .sf-sub-indicator, li.sfHover > a > .sf-sub-indicator{background-position:-10px -100px;}
.sf-menu ul .sf-sub-indicator{background-position:-10px 0;}
#main-navigation .sf-menu ul .sf-sub-indicator{background-position:-10px 0;}
.sf-menu ul a > .sf-sub-indicator{background-position:0 0;}
.sf-menu ul a:focus > .sf-sub-indicator, .sf-menu ul a:hover > .sf-sub-indicator, .sf-menu ul a:active > .sf-sub-indicator, .sf-menu ul li:hover > a > .sf-sub-indicator, .sf-menu ul li.sfHover > a > .sf-sub-indicator{background-position:-10px 0;}
.sf-shadow ul{}
.sf-shadow ul.sf-shadow-off{}
.top-nav .sf-arrows .sf-with-ul:after{content:'';position:absolute;top:50%;right:1em;margin-top:-2px;height:0;width:0;border:5px solid transparent;border-top-color:#dFeEFF;border-top-color:rgba(255,255,255,.5);}
.top-nav .sf-arrows li.have_desc .sf-with-ul:after{margin-top:-8px;}
.top-nav .sf-arrows > li > .sf-with-ul:focus:after,
.top-nav .sf-arrows > li:hover > .sf-with-ul:after,
.top-nav .sf-arrows > .sfHover > .sf-with-ul:after{border-top-color:white;}
.top-nav .sf-arrows ul .sf-with-ul:after{margin-top:-5px;margin-right:-3px;border-color:transparent;border-left-color:#dFeEFF;border-left-color:rgba(255,255,255,.5);}
.top-nav .sf-arrows ul li > .sf-with-ul:focus:after,
.top-nav .sf-arrows ul li:hover > .sf-with-ul:after,
.top-nav .sf-arrows ul .sfHover > .sf-with-ul:after{border-left-color:white;}
.main-nav .sf-arrows .sf-with-ul:after{content:'';position:absolute;top:50%;right:1em;margin-top:-2px;height:0;width:0;border:5px solid transparent;border-top-color:#000;border-top-color:rgba(0,0,0,.5);}
.main-nav .sf-arrows li.have_desc .sf-with-ul:after{margin-top:-8px;}
.main-nav .sf-arrows > li > .sf-with-ul:focus:after,
.main-nav .sf-arrows > li:hover > .sf-with-ul:after,
.main-nav .sf-arrows > .sfHover > .sf-with-ul:after{border-top-color:white;}
.main-nav .sf-arrows ul .sf-with-ul:after{margin-top:-5px;margin-right:-3px;border-color:transparent;border-left-color:#dFeEFF;border-left-color:rgba(255,255,255,.5);}
.main-nav .sf-arrows ul li > .sf-with-ul:focus:after,
.main-nav .sf-arrows ul li:hover > .sf-with-ul:after,
.main-nav .sf-arrows ul .sfHover > .sf-with-ul:after{border-left-color:white;}